Why Go Gluten-Free Vegan? The Dietary Revolution
The rise in popularity of gluten-free and vegan diets isn't just a trend; it's a response to genuine health needs and ethical considerations. For many, a gluten-free diet is essential due to celiac disease or non-celiac gluten sensitivity. Similarly, dairy and egg allergies or intolerances are common, with some individuals finding relief from symptoms when eliminating these ingredients – particularly during periods of gut healing, as observed by many in the allergy-friendly community. Beyond allergies, an increasing number of people are embracing a vegan or plant-based lifestyle for ethical, environmental, or health reasons. Unlocking the Fluff Factor: The Science Behind Pillowy Perfection
So, how do you achieve such an ethereal, fluffy texture in gluten free vegan pancakes without the conventional ingredients that traditionally provide structure and lift? It all comes down to a clever combination of plant-based substitutes and chemical reactions.
The Magic of a Flax Egg
In traditional baking, eggs serve multiple purposes: binding ingredients, providing moisture, and contributing to leavening. In this vegan marvel, ground flaxseed steps in as the ultimate egg replacer, creating what's known as a "flax egg." When ground flaxseed is mixed with a liquid (like your dairy-free milk), it forms a gelatinous binder that holds the pancake together beautifully, preventing crumbling and adding a subtle richness. It's a simple yet powerful substitution that is crucial for the structure and tenderness of these pancakes.
Leavening Agents: Your Key to Rise
The secret to those beautiful air pockets and significant lift lies in the dynamic duo of baking powder and baking soda. Baking powder is a complete leavener, containing both acid and base, which reacts when wet and heated. Baking soda, on the other hand, is a base that needs an acidic component to activate it fully. This recipe incorporates apple cider vinegar (or lemon juice), which reacts with the baking soda to produce carbon dioxide gas. These tiny bubbles get trapped within the batter, expanding as they cook, resulting in pancakes that are incredibly light and airy – truly fluffy gluten free pancakes.
The Power of the Right Gluten-Free Flour Blend
Perhaps the most critical component for exceptional gluten free vegan pancakes is the flour blend. A single gluten-free flour rarely replicates the qualities of wheat flour. This recipe champions a specific homemade blend for optimal results, combining:
- Sorghum Flour: Provides a sturdy structure and a slightly sweet, mild flavor, preventing the pancakes from becoming gummy.
- Potato Starch: Contributes to a tender crumb and light texture, absorbing moisture without making the batter heavy.
- Tapioca Starch: Adds elasticity and chewiness, preventing the pancakes from being too dry or crumbly.
While commercial 1:1 gluten-free flour blends can be convenient, many contain ingredients like xanthan gum or guar gum, which can sometimes lead to a slightly different texture. Crafting your own blend, as suggested, allows for precise control over the final product, ensuring consistently pillowy pancakes. Store your custom blend in an airtight container for easy future use!
Mastering the Batter & Pan
Beyond the ingredients, proper technique is essential. Mixing the wet and dry ingredients separately before combining them ensures even distribution. Sifting your dry ingredients prevents lumps and aerates the flour, contributing to a lighter batter. When combining, mix just until the ingredients are thoroughly incorporated. A few small lumps are perfectly fine and even desirable; overmixing can develop any gums in your GF blend or make the pancakes tough. Finally, cooking on a medium-hot skillet is key – too low, and they won't brown properly; too high, and they'll burn before cooking through. Look for bubbles breaking on the surface and dry edges as your cue to flip, ensuring a beautiful golden brown on both sides.
Your Effortless Recipe for Fluffy Gluten-Free Vegan Pancakes
Ready to create your own stack of culinary perfection? Here’s a detailed guide to making these easy gluten free vegan pancakes.
Essential Ingredients
- 1 ¾ cups plain dairy-free milk beverage of choice (almond, soy, oat, or cashew work wonderfully)
- ¼ cup oil (plus extra for the skillet)
- 2 tablespoons ground flaxseed
- 2 tablespoons agave nectar or maple syrup (honey if not strictly vegan)
- 2 teaspoons apple cider vinegar or l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 cups Gluten-Free Flour Blend (for DIY blend: combine 4 cups sorghum flour, 1 1/3 cups potato starch, and 2/3 cup tapioca starch; store in an airtight container. Alternatively, use a trusted commercial 1:1 blend)
- 1 tablespo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- Optional toppings: Maple syrup, fresh fruit, drizzly nut or seed butter, coconut whip, chocolate chips
Step-by-Step Method
- Prepare Wet Ingredients: In a glass measuring cup or medium bowl, whisk together the dairy-free milk, ¼ cup oil, ground flaxseed, agave nectar (or chosen sweetener), apple cider vinegar, and vanilla extract. Set aside for 5-10 minutes to allow the flaxseed to gel and activate.
- Combine Dry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, sift together the gluten-free flour blend,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Sifting helps to aerate the flour and ensures even distribution of the leavening agents, preventing lumps.
- Mix Batter: Pour the wet ingredient mixture into the dry ingredients. Mix gently with a whisk or spatula until just combined. A few small lumps are normal; avoid overmixing, as this can lead to a tougher pancake.
- Heat Skillet: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Add a small drizzle of oil (such as coconut or vegetable oil) and spread evenly.
- Cook Pancakes: Using roughly ¼ cup of batter per pancake, pour onto the hot skillet. Cook for about 3 minutes, or until the outside edges begin to look dry and bubbles start to break on the surface of the batter.
- Flip and Finish: Carefully flip the pancakes and cook for another 2 minutes, or until both sides are light golden brown and cooked through.
- Serve: Transfer the cooked pancakes to a plate and serve immediately with your favorite toppings.
Customizing Your Stack: Variations & Topping Ideas
Part of the joy of making your own pancakes is the ability to tailor them to your exact preferences.
Flour Blend Wisdom
As mentioned, a favorite gluten-free flour blend for these specific pancakes is a combination of 4 cups sorghum flour, 1 1/3 cups potato starch, and 2/3 cup tapioca starch. This blend yields exceptional results, but you can certainly experiment with high-quality commercial 1:1 gluten-free flour blends. Just be mindful that you might need minor adjustments to liquid content, as different blends absorb moisture differently.
Texture Tailoring
Do you prefer a thicker, cakier pancake or a lighter, thinner one? This recipe is incredibly adaptable:
- For Cakier Pancakes: Reduce the dairy-free milk beverage by up to ¼ cup (using 1 ½ cups total). This creates a slightly thicker batter that yields a denser, more substantial pancake.
- For Thinner Pancakes: Increase the dairy-free milk beverage by up to ¼ cup (using 2 cups total). This thins the batter, resulting in lighter, more delicate pancakes that spread a bit more.
Sweetener & Milk Choices
While agave nectar is recommended, pure maple syrup is an excellent vegan alternative that provides a rich flavor. For dairy-free milk, almond, soy, oat, or cashew milk are all great choices. Each may impart a slightly different subtle flavor, so feel free to use your favorite.

Make-Ahead Mastery: Enjoying Fluffy Pancakes Any Day
One of the greatest benefits of these easy gluten free vegan pancakes is their freezer-friendliness. Batch cooking means you can enjoy a wholesome, delicious breakfast even on the busiest mornings. To store leftovers, simply flash freeze the cooled pancakes in a single layer on a baking sheet. Once solid, transfer them to a zip-top baggie, pressing out as much air as possible before sealing. Store them in the freezer for weeks, ready to be enjoyed straight from the toaster or microwave whenever a craving strikes.
